所有的文章都来自于AI生成,其仅用于SEO之目的。

如果你来到了这里,欢迎使用我们精心打造的应用或游戏。

点击此处飞燕工作室,你将可以发现很多精彩的苹果iOS应用!


## 移动优先:打造卓越H5网页浏览体验

随着移动互联网的飞速发展,移动设备已经成为人们获取信息、进行交流和娱乐的主要工具。而H5网页,作为一种基于HTML5标准的网页形式,凭借其跨平台、轻量化、交互性强等优势,在移动端得到了广泛应用。无论是新闻资讯、电商购物、游戏娱乐,还是企业宣传、在线教育、品牌推广,H5网页都扮演着重要的角色。

然而,仅仅拥有H5网页是不够的。要想在竞争激烈的移动互联网市场脱颖而出,提供卓越的H5网页浏览体验至关重要。这意味着网页必须加载迅速、响应灵敏、内容精美、操作流畅,才能吸引并留住用户,最终实现商业目标。本文将深入探讨如何打造卓越的H5网页浏览体验,从页面设计、性能优化、交互设计、安全策略等多个方面进行剖析,为开发者提供全面的指导。

**一、页面设计:视觉冲击与内容为王**

一个好的H5网页,首先要具备吸引人的外观。精美的视觉设计能够瞬间抓住用户的眼球,激发其进一步探索的欲望。

* **风格定位:明确主题,保持一致性。** 在开始设计之前,要明确H5网页的主题和目标受众。根据主题选择合适的色彩、字体、图片和动画,并确保整个页面风格的统一性。避免使用过于花哨的元素,以免分散用户的注意力。
* **色彩搭配:遵循配色原则,创造视觉和谐。** 色彩是影响用户情绪的重要因素。要根据H5网页的主题选择合适的色彩方案,并遵循配色原则,例如互补色、对比色、相似色等。避免使用过于刺眼的颜色组合,以免造成视觉疲劳。
* **字体选择:清晰易读,注重排版。** 选择合适的字体至关重要,要保证字体清晰易读,尤其是在移动设备的小屏幕上。同时,要注重字体的大小、行距和间距等排版细节,创造舒适的阅读体验。
* **图片与视频:优化资源,提升加载速度。** 图片和视频是H5网页中重要的组成部分,但同时也可能影响加载速度。要对图片进行压缩,减少文件大小。视频应采用流媒体格式,并进行适当的码率调整。同时,可以使用CDN(内容分发网络)加速资源加载。
* **响应式设计:适应不同设备,保证最佳呈现。** 移动设备的屏幕尺寸各不相同,因此要采用响应式设计,使H5网页能够自动适应不同的屏幕尺寸,保证在各种设备上都能呈现最佳效果。

然而,光有漂亮的“外壳”是不够的,H5网页的核心价值在于内容。优质的内容能够吸引用户停留,并产生共鸣。

* **内容策划:围绕主题,精简凝练。** 要围绕H5网页的主题进行内容策划,确保内容与主题相关,并具有吸引力。同时,要精简内容,避免冗长和重复。利用图片、视频和动画等元素,将内容以生动形象的方式呈现出来。
* **信息架构:层级清晰,易于导航。** 要合理组织H5网页的信息架构,确保层级清晰,易于导航。用户能够快速找到自己感兴趣的内容,并流畅地浏览整个页面。
* **故事讲述:引人入胜,触动内心。** 通过故事讲述的方式呈现内容,能够更好地吸引用户的注意力,并触动其内心。故事要真实、感人,并与H5网页的主题相关。
* **互动元素:增加趣味性,提升参与度。** 在内容中加入互动元素,例如问答、投票、抽奖等,能够增加趣味性,提升用户的参与度。

**二、性能优化:速度至上,流畅体验**

在移动端,用户的耐心是有限的。如果H5网页加载速度过慢,或者运行卡顿,很容易导致用户流失。因此,性能优化是打造卓越H5网页浏览体验的关键。

* **减少HTTP请求:合并资源,降低开销。** 每次HTTP请求都会增加服务器的负担,降低加载速度。因此,要尽可能减少HTTP请求,例如合并CSS和JavaScript文件,使用CSS Sprites等。
* **压缩资源文件:缩小体积,加快传输。** 压缩CSS、JavaScript和HTML等资源文件,可以显著缩小文件体积,加快传输速度。可以使用Gzip等压缩算法。
* **使用CDN加速:就近访问,缩短延迟。** CDN能够将H5网页的静态资源分发到全球各地的服务器上,用户可以从离自己最近的服务器访问资源,从而缩短延迟,加快加载速度。
* **优化图片:选择格式,控制大小。** 图片是影响加载速度的重要因素。要选择合适的图片格式,例如JPEG、PNG或WebP。同时,要控制图片的大小,可以使用图片压缩工具进行优化。
* **延迟加载:优先加载关键内容。** 对于非关键内容,可以采用延迟加载的方式,即在用户滚动到相应区域时再加载。这样可以优先加载关键内容,提高初始加载速度。
* **代码优化:精简代码,提高效率。** 精简代码,去除冗余和无用代码,可以提高代码的执行效率,降低内存占用。可以使用代码压缩工具进行优化。
* **避免重排重绘:优化动画,减少消耗。** 重排和重绘会消耗大量的计算资源,影响页面性能。要尽量避免重排重绘,例如使用transform代替top/left进行动画。

**三、交互设计:操作便捷,体验友好**

好的交互设计能够让用户感到舒适和愉悦,从而提升用户体验。

* **简化操作:减少点击,提高效率。** 在移动端,用户的操作习惯与PC端不同。要尽可能简化操作,减少点击次数,提高操作效率。
* **明确反馈:及时响应,避免困惑。** 用户执行操作后,要及时给予明确的反馈,例如按钮点击状态变化、加载动画等,避免用户产生困惑。
* **流畅过渡:自然衔接,提升流畅度。** 页面之间的过渡要流畅自然,可以使用动画效果进行衔接,提升整体流畅度。
* **手势支持:充分利用触摸屏特性。** 移动设备支持多种手势操作,例如滑动、捏合、旋转等。要充分利用这些手势特性,提供更便捷的操作方式。
* **无障碍设计:关注特殊用户需求。** 要关注特殊用户的需求,例如视力障碍者,提供无障碍设计,例如增加文字大小、提供语音导航等。

**四、安全策略:防范风险,保护用户**

H5网页也存在一定的安全风险,例如XSS攻击、CSRF攻击等。因此,要采取必要的安全策略,保护用户的信息安全。

* **输入验证:过滤恶意代码。** 对于用户输入的任何数据,都要进行严格的验证,过滤恶意代码,防止XSS攻击。
* **输出编码:转义特殊字符。** 在将用户输入的数据输出到页面时,要进行适当的编码,转义特殊字符,防止XSS攻击。
* **CSRF防护:使用Token或验证码。** CSRF攻击是指攻击者冒充用户执行操作。要使用Token或验证码等方式,防止CSRF攻击。
* **HTTPS加密:保护数据传输安全。** 使用HTTPS加密协议,可以保护数据在传输过程中的安全,防止数据被窃取或篡改。
* **定期更新:修复漏洞,防范攻击。** 要定期更新H5网页所使用的框架和组件,及时修复安全漏洞,防范各种攻击。

**总结:**

打造卓越的H5网页浏览体验是一个持续改进的过程。需要开发者不断学习新的技术,关注用户反馈,并进行持续的优化。只有这样,才能在竞争激烈的移动互联网市场中脱颖而出,赢得用户的青睐,最终实现商业目标。移动优先,用户至上,是打造卓越H5网页浏览体验的核心理念。